Online 🇮🇳
Ecommerce Ecommerce WordPress WordPress Web Design Web Design Speed Speed Optimization SEO SEO Hosting Hosting Maintenance Maintenance Consultation Free Consultation Now accepting new projects for 2024-25!

“`html

Top Web Development Services: A Comprehensive Guide

Navigating the world of web development can feel overwhelming. With so many services available, choosing the right one for your project is critical. This guide breaks down the top web development services, offering insights to help you make informed decisions. 🛠️ Let’s build something amazing!

What Are Web Development Services?

Web development services encompass the entire process of building and maintaining websites and web applications. They range from front-end development (what users see and interact with) to back-end development (the server-side logic and database management) and everything in between. 🎯

Why Do You Need Web Development Services?

Whether you’re a startup, a small business, or a large enterprise, web development services are essential for:

  • Establishing an online presence.
  • Reaching a wider audience.
  • Generating leads and sales.
  • Providing customer service.
  • Streamlining business operations.

A well-developed website is your digital storefront, your 24/7 salesperson, and your primary communication channel.

How to Choose the Right Web Development Service

Selecting the right service provider depends on your specific needs and goals. Consider these factors:

  • Project Scope: Is it a simple website, a complex web application, or something in between?
  • Budget: How much can you spend on development?
  • Timeline: When do you need the project completed?
  • Technical Expertise: What technologies and frameworks are required?
  • Ongoing Maintenance: Will you need support and updates after launch?

Top Web Development Services: A Breakdown

Here’s a look at some of the leading web development service categories:

Custom Web Development

Custom web development involves building a website or web application from scratch, tailored to your specific requirements. This offers maximum flexibility and control.

Benefits: Custom solutions, tailored to your exact needs; scalability; and unique features. ✅

Suitable for: Businesses with unique needs, complex projects, and high growth potential.

Web Design and UI/UX

Focuses on the visual aspects of a website, user experience (UX), and user interface (UI) design. This service ensures your website is visually appealing, user-friendly, and optimized for conversions.

Benefits: Enhanced user experience, improved conversion rates, and a strong brand identity.

Suitable for: Businesses looking to improve their website’s design, usability, and user engagement.

E-commerce Development

Specializes in building online stores, including features like product catalogs, shopping carts, payment gateways, and order management.

Benefits: Ability to sell products online, streamlined e-commerce processes, and increased sales potential.

Suitable for: Businesses that want to sell products or services online.

CMS Development

Involves building websites using Content Management Systems (CMS) like WordPress, Drupal, or Joomla. This allows for easy content updates and management.

Benefits: Easy content management, cost-effective solutions, and a wide range of themes and plugins.

Suitable for: Businesses needing to update their website content regularly.

Mobile App Development

Focuses on creating mobile applications for iOS and Android platforms.

Benefits: Increased user engagement, access to mobile users, and improved brand visibility.

Suitable for: Businesses wanting to provide a mobile experience for their users.

Web Application Development

This service creates interactive web applications, often used for complex functions. These can be SaaS platforms, project management tools, or internal business applications.

Benefits: Automation of key business processes, specialized functionality, and enhanced productivity.

Suitable for: Businesses needing complex, interactive web tools.

Benefits of Using Web Development Services

  • Expertise: Access to skilled professionals with specialized knowledge.
  • Efficiency: Faster project completion and reduced development time.
  • Quality: Professional-grade code and design.
  • Scalability: Ability to adapt and grow your website as your business expands.
  • Focus: Allows you to focus on your core business while experts handle the technical aspects.

Risks of Using Web Development Services

  • Cost: Development services can be expensive, especially for custom projects.
  • Communication: Miscommunication can lead to project delays or misunderstandings.
  • Vendor Lock-in: You may become dependent on the service provider for ongoing maintenance.
  • Security: Risk of security vulnerabilities if the provider does not prioritize security best practices.

Web Development Services Comparison

Service Best For Pros Cons
Custom Web Development Unique requirements, complex projects Full customization, scalability Higher cost, longer development time
Web Design & UI/UX Improving user experience, brand identity Improved user engagement, higher conversion rates Focus on aesthetics, less on functionality
E-commerce Development Selling products online Online sales, streamlined e-commerce processes Security concerns, payment gateway integration
CMS Development Easy content management Cost-effective, easy content updates Limited customization, potential for security vulnerabilities
Mobile App Development Mobile user engagement Increased user engagement, brand visibility Platform-specific, ongoing maintenance
Web Application Development Complex web tools Specialized functionality, automation Higher complexity, longer development time

Frequently Asked Questions (FAQs)

Here are answers to some common questions about web development services: 💡

What’s the difference between front-end and back-end development?

Front-end development deals with the user interface (what the user sees and interacts with), while back-end development handles the server-side logic, databases, and application functionality.

How much does web development cost?

The cost varies greatly depending on the project’s complexity, features, and the service provider’s rates. Custom projects generally cost more than template-based solutions.

How long does it take to develop a website?

The timeline depends on the project scope. Simple websites might take a few weeks, while complex web applications can take several months.

What questions should I ask a web development company?

Ask about their experience, portfolio, development process, pricing, support, and ongoing maintenance options.

How do I maintain my website after it’s launched?

Maintenance involves regular updates, security patches, content updates, and performance optimization. Many web development services offer ongoing maintenance plans.

“`
“`html

Top Web Development Services

The world of web development offers a diverse range of services, each catering to specific needs and project requirements. Choosing the right services is crucial for building a successful and effective online presence. This section delves into some of the most sought-after and critical web development services.

1. Front-End Development

Front-end development focuses on the user interface (UI) and user experience (UX) of a website. It involves creating the visual elements and interactive features that users directly interact with.

  • Key Technologies: HTML, CSS, JavaScript, and related frameworks (React, Angular, Vue.js).
  • Services Offered:
    • UI/UX Design Implementation
    • Responsive Design Development
    • Interactive Element Development (buttons, forms, animations)
    • Performance Optimization (speed and efficiency)

2. Back-End Development

Back-end development handles the server-side logic, databases, and application architecture that power a website’s functionality. It’s the engine room behind the scenes.

  • Key Technologies: Programming languages (Python, Java, PHP, Node.js), databases (MySQL, PostgreSQL, MongoDB), server management.
  • Services Offered:
    • Server-Side Logic Development
    • Database Design and Management
    • API Development and Integration
    • Security Implementation

3. Full-Stack Development

Full-stack development encompasses both front-end and back-end development. Full-stack developers possess a comprehensive understanding of all aspects of web application development.

  • Key Skills: Proficiency in both front-end and back-end technologies, strong problem-solving abilities.
  • Services Offered: Complete Web Application Development, End-to-End Project Management.

4. E-commerce Development

E-commerce development specializes in building online stores and platforms for selling products and services. This includes features like product catalogs, shopping carts, and payment gateway integration.

  • Key Platforms: Shopify, WooCommerce, Magento, custom e-commerce solutions.
  • Services Offered:
    • E-commerce Platform Implementation
    • Payment Gateway Integration
    • Shopping Cart Development
    • Product Catalog Management

5. Web Application Development

Web application development focuses on creating complex, interactive web applications that provide specific functionalities, such as social networking, project management, or content management.

  • Services Offered:
    • Custom Web Application Development
    • Software-as-a-Service (SaaS) Development
    • API Integration
    • Scalability and Performance Optimization

6. Web Design

Web design focuses on the visual appearance and user experience of a website. This includes layout, typography, color schemes, and overall aesthetics.

  • Services Offered:
    • UI/UX Design
    • Website Mockups and Prototypes
    • Responsive Design Implementation
    • Branding and Visual Identity

7. Website Maintenance and Support

This crucial service ensures a website remains functional, secure, and up-to-date. It includes regular updates, bug fixes, and security patches.

  • Services Offered:
    • Website Updates and Maintenance
    • Security Audits and Vulnerability Assessments
    • Bug Fixing and Troubleshooting
    • Performance Monitoring and Optimization

Advanced Tables for Service Comparison

Service Primary Focus Key Technologies Typical Clients
Front-End Development User Interface and User Experience HTML, CSS, JavaScript, React, Angular, Vue.js Businesses needing visually appealing and interactive websites.
Back-End Development Server-Side Logic and Database Management Python, Java, PHP, Node.js, MySQL, PostgreSQL, MongoDB Businesses needing data-driven and functional web applications.
Full-Stack Development Complete Web Application Development Combination of Front-End and Back-End technologies Startups and businesses with comprehensive development needs.
E-commerce Development Online Store Functionality Shopify, WooCommerce, Magento, Payment Gateways Businesses selling products or services online.
Web Application Development Complex Web Application Functionality Various Programming Languages and Frameworks Businesses needing custom web-based tools and platforms.
Web Design Visual Appearance and User Experience UI/UX Design Principles, Design Software Businesses needing a visually appealing and user-friendly website.
Website Maintenance and Support Website Upkeep and Security Server Management Tools, Security Protocols All businesses with existing websites.

Best Practices

  • Prioritize User Experience (UX): Design websites that are intuitive and easy to navigate.
  • Ensure Responsiveness: Develop websites that adapt to different screen sizes and devices.
  • Focus on Performance: Optimize website speed and efficiency for a better user experience.
  • Implement Strong Security Measures: Protect websites from vulnerabilities and cyber threats.
  • Choose the Right Technologies: Select technologies that align with project requirements and scalability needs.
  • Maintain Regular Backups: Ensure data safety and quick recovery in case of issues.

Frequently Asked Questions (FAQs)

What is the difference between front-end and back-end development?

Front-end development focuses on the user interface and what the user sees and interacts with. Back-end development handles the server-side logic, databases, and application architecture that powers the website’s functionality.

What is a full-stack developer?

A full-stack developer is proficient in both front-end and back-end technologies, capable of handling all aspects of web application development.

What is the importance of responsive design?

Responsive design ensures that a website adapts to different screen sizes and devices, providing a consistent and optimal user experience across all platforms.

Why is website maintenance important?

Website maintenance ensures that a website remains functional, secure, and up-to-date. It includes regular updates, bug fixes, and security patches, protecting the website from vulnerabilities and ensuring optimal performance.

“`
“`html

Top Web Development Services

What Web Development Services Entail

Web development encompasses a wide array of services essential for creating and maintaining websites and web applications. These services are crucial for businesses and individuals looking to establish an online presence, enhance user experiences, and achieve their digital goals.

  • Frontend Development: Focuses on the user interface and user experience (UI/UX).
  • Backend Development: Deals with server-side logic, databases, and application integration.
  • Full-stack Development: Combines both frontend and backend expertise.
  • Web Design: Involves the visual aspects and user experience of a website.
  • E-commerce Development: Specializes in creating online stores.

Key Web Development Services

Here’s a breakdown of some of the most sought-after web development services:

  • Website Design and Development: Creating the visual layout and functionality of a website.
  • E-commerce Solutions: Building online stores with features like product catalogs, shopping carts, and payment gateways.
  • Web Application Development: Developing interactive applications accessible through a web browser.
  • Content Management Systems (CMS): Implementing and customizing systems like WordPress or Drupal.
  • Mobile-First Development: Ensuring websites are responsive and optimized for mobile devices.
  • SEO Implementation: Optimizing websites for search engines.
  • Website Maintenance and Support: Providing ongoing updates, bug fixes, and technical support.

Choosing the Right Web Development Company

Selecting the right web development company is crucial for project success. Consider the following factors:

  • Experience and Portfolio: Review their past projects to assess their expertise.
  • Technical Skills: Ensure they have the necessary skills in relevant technologies.
  • Communication and Project Management: Assess their communication style and project management capabilities.
  • Pricing and Value: Compare pricing models and evaluate the overall value offered.
  • Client Reviews and Testimonials: Read reviews to gauge client satisfaction.

Myths vs. Facts

Debunking common misconceptions about web development:

  • Myth: Web development is easy and can be done quickly.

    Fact: Creating a high-quality website or application requires expertise, time, and careful planning.
  • Myth: Hiring the cheapest developer will save you money.

    Fact: Often, cheaper options may lead to lower quality and increased long-term costs.
  • Myth: You don’t need to update your website after it’s launched.

    Fact: Regular updates are essential for security, performance, and user experience.

SEO Tips for Web Development

Implementing SEO best practices during web development is critical for online visibility:

  • Keyword Research: Identify relevant keywords for your content.
  • On-Page Optimization: Optimize title tags, meta descriptions, and headings.
  • Mobile Responsiveness: Ensure your website is mobile-friendly.
  • Site Speed Optimization: Improve website loading times.
  • Content Creation: Publish high-quality, engaging content regularly.
  • Internal Linking: Link to relevant pages within your website.

Glossary

Key terms often used in web development:

Term Definition
Frontend The part of a website or application that users interact with.
Backend The server-side of a website or application, including databases and server logic.
Responsive Design Web design that adapts to different screen sizes and devices.
API Application Programming Interface; allows different software applications to communicate.
CMS Content Management System; software for managing website content.

Common Mistakes to Avoid

Common pitfalls to prevent during web development:

  • Ignoring Mobile Responsiveness: Not ensuring your website looks good on all devices.
  • Poor Website Navigation: Making it difficult for users to find what they need.
  • Slow Website Speed: Slow loading times can frustrate users and hurt SEO.
  • Lack of Security: Not implementing proper security measures.
  • Neglecting SEO: Failing to optimize your website for search engines.

“`

Scroll to Top